Lightpoint Medical develops miniaturised cancer detection tools designed for use in robot-assisted surgery. The firm creates compact imaging systems to help surgeons identify cancerous tissue in real time.

Lightpoint Medical has secured £5.8m in a Series C financing round to support the commercial rollout of its robotic cancer detection probe. The investment saw participation from the British Business Bank Future Fund, alongside existing backers including Oxford Technology, Venture Founders, and Coutts Bank. The fresh capital will fund expanded clinical trials and early commercialisation of the company's SENSEI device.

The raise follows recent regulatory approvals for the robotic probe in Europe, the United States, and Australia. Lightpoint has already established distribution partnerships in several markets and plans to widen its international reach over the coming months as clinical studies continue across multiple cancer types.
